    <description>Provisional release of seized excisable goods was considered where an earlier judicial direction required the authorities to decide the release application after notice, but no compliance was shown. The Court directed release of the goods if no order had yet been passed in terms of that earlier direction, making relief conditional on the petitioner executing bonds and furnishing security in the form of National Saving Certificates or other acceptable certificates under the applicable excise rules. The operative effect was a conditional direction for release of the seized goods, subject to compliance with the prescribed security requirements.</description>
